Wildlife relocation is not the answer and it’s especially harmful at this time of year #wildlifeAdded:
We arrived on this job site and the customer has hired her lawn care company to try to solve her raccoon problem. And this is the difference between professionals doing wildlife control and people that just really don't understand what it takes. So, this individual has set a trap up on the roof, tied the trap to the two roof fence, and you can see where it's attached at the front here. The idea was the raccoon would come out of the hole, go into the trap and and eat this lovely meal at the back, which looks like a roast beef sandwich, which is pretty good on fine china. And what would ultimately happen here is the raccoon would get caught, struggle like heck to get out. These weak pieces of string would break and the raccoon would have a horrible time falling off the roof and landing on that cement patio. Chances are it would be badly injured as a result. And at this time of year, trapping and relocating isn't a good idea anyways because often you're leaving babies behind in the attic, taking mom many miles away, and the babies simply die of starvation without her. So hire a professional um that's going to deal with this problem properly and be conscious of the fact that there are babies and take out the mother humanely. Wait.
